Spring City tries again to Shake the Lake - July 19

The town of Spring City, Tenn., will present its delayed Fourth of July celebration, Shake the Lake, this weekend.

Events include a block party on Front Street from 7 to 10 p.m. Friday, July 19. Shake the Lake will be a daylong festival on Saturday, July 20, at Veterans Park off New Lake Road.

Saturday's schedule starts off with a pageant at 10 a.m. (registration opens at 9 a.m.). There are 10 categories of competition for newborns to children up to age 8.

Sign-ups for watermelon and pickle-eating contests will be held from noon to 1 p.m. The contests will be held back-to-back, with pickle eaters at 1 p.m. and watermelon eaters at 1:30 p.m.

Karaoke singing is scheduled from 2 to 3 p.m.

From 3 to 3:45 p.m., there will be sign-ups for a Diaper Derby at 4 p.m. and a Teddy Bear Run at 4:15 p.m. A duck race will follow at 5 p.m. Other games and activities will be held throughout the day, with prizes awarded.

Starting at 6 p.m., Corey Rose and Evervigilant will provide entertainment. Fireworks will start at dark.

The celebration was originally scheduled for July 6 but was postponed because of rain.
